| ดรากอน draaM gaawnM (13.) | ![]() |
| pronunciation guide | |
| Phonemic Thai | ดฺรา-กอน |
| IPA | draː kɔːn |
| Royal Thai General System | drakon |
| pronunciation note | 13. Double consonant combination ดร is transcribed as 'DR'. This is usually only the case for loanwords from other languages such as English. Some Thais may pronounce it as ดะ-ร- | ||
| [noun, loanword, English] | |||
| definition | [Thai transcription of the foreign loanword] dragon | ||
| example | ดอกสแนปดรากอน ![]() ![]() | daawkL saL naaepF draaM gaawnM | snapdragon |
